"Lord, teach us to pray."


Luke 11:1


The request for instruction in prayer could be made for all of our lives. We know that we come before God in Christ with the assurance of being heard. We need help knowing what to pray in each circumstance.

Let us not assume that we know God's will or the best answer to our prayers. Approach the Lord with humility in each request, acknowledging His will and the Spirit's help in bringing our prayers to God.

We could say," Lord, teach us to pray." Teach me to be led by you, to accept your will, and to trust you for what is best. Teach us to approach every need with your eyes and pray accordingly. To see others as you do and pray with that understanding. May we have faith in God and pray with a firm conviction that nothing is impossible. Teach us to pray today.
